Urifrix 1.4gm Syrup is a medicine used in the treatment of gout and kidney stones. Urifrix 1.4gm Syrup can be taken with or without food. This will prevent you from getting an upset stomach. Take it regularly and do not stop taking the medicine even if you get better until your doctor tells you it is alright to stop. The most common side effect of this medicine is stomach pain. It may also cause diarrhea, nausea, vomiting, frequent urge to urinate, and tiredness. If any of these side effects do not resolve with time or get worsen, you should let your doctor know. Your doctor may help with ways to reduce or prevent these symptoms by reducing the dose or prescribing an alternative medicine.
Urifrix 1.4gm Syrup is a urine alkalizer. It works by increasing the pH of urine which makes it less acidic. This helps the kidneys get rid of excess uric acid thereby preventing gout and certain types of kidney stones.
How should I use Urifrix 1.4gm Syrup?
Use Urifrix 1.4gm Syrup exactly as directed by your doctor. Before each dose, shake the bottle well and mix it with water or juice as advised by your doctor. To avoid stomach upset, drink plenty of fluids while taking this medicine.
How long does it take for Urifrix 1.4gm Syrup to start working?
Urifrix 1.4gm Syrup typically starts working within a few minutes. Its effects can last for approximately four to six hours. To get the most benefits, do not skip doses and use it as directed by your doctor.
What happens if I take too much Urifrix 1.4gm Syrup?
Taking more than the recommended dose of Urifrix 1.4gm Syrup will not help you recover faster but may increase the risk of side effects. Always follow your doctor's instructions and do not double your dose, even if you forget to take it.
